After a week of break, it is time for Tech3 KTM Factory Racing to head to Sachsenring for the Grand Prix of Germany, the first race of the last double header before the summer break. Without Marc Marquez, the King of Sachsenring, cards are set to be redistributed and we will be looking forward to seeing how rookies Remy Gardner and Raul Fernandez perform on the short German layout, with its thirteen corners including ten on the left.
Remy Gardner is coming from his best MotoGP result in Catalunya with a P11 finish, and will be targeting to score points again. Last season in Moto2, he finished on the first step of the podium and will be looking forward to trying this layout with his MotoGP bike. Teammate Raul Fernandez scored his first point in the category at the last Grand Prix, and will be hoping to score more in Sachsenring, a circuit where he holds the lap record in the Moto2 category after reaching the pole position in 2021.
The action will start on Friday at 9:55 (GMT+2) with the first free practice session, followed by the second one at 14:10, both of forty-five minutes each. On Saturday, the action will resume with the third free practice at 9:55, at the end of which qualifying entries will be determined. There will be a final chance to practice at 13:30 with FP4, before the qualifying sessions start at 14:10. The lights of the Grand Prix of Germany will go out on Sunday, June 19, at 14:00 for thirty laps.

Remy Gardner
Championship: 23rd
Points: 8
"I am looking forward to heading to Sachsenring where I had a lot of success last season. We had a positive test day in Catalunya and it looks like we found better directions to take for the next couple of races. The target will be to score points again, so let’s see what we can do this week!"

Raul Fernandez
Championship: 24th
Points: 1
"We are heading to the last two races before the summer break, as we start with Germany. It will be important to finish this first half of the season with good sensations on the bike. We got some positives from the test in Catalunya, which I hope we will be able to build on for the next races, take a step and get closer to the riders in front."

Hervé Poncharal
Team Manager
"After a constructive weekend in Catalunya and a very positive test on Monday, the Tech3 KTM Factory Racing team is heading to Germany full of confidence. We all remember last year the great race from Miguel Oliveira who finished second. Both Remy Gardner and Raul Fernandez had a strong race at the last Grand Prix and it was the first race at the end of which we got points from both riders, which is our best result of the season so far. Our rookies are not really rookies anymore and this result came at the right time because the transfer market is booming right now. We really believe that both will be able to start the action on Friday in the same positive dynamic as in Catalunya, and I am hoping that we will be competitive and score points again.
There are always plenty of KTM fans in Sachsenring, and we intend to carry the KTM flag high as we know that this race is important for the whole family. As usual, we will push and do our best to put on a great show."
